    Mary Sweet-Darter, Ph.D., has joined the psychology faculty at Northeastern State University.Although new to Northeastern and OSPA, she is not new to Oklahoma.Dr. Sweet-Darter is returning to Oklahoma after completing a Leadership in Neurodevelopmental Disabilities (LEND) postdoctoral fellowship at Johns Hopkins University School of Medicine and a subsequent appointment to the School Psychology staff at the Kennedy Krieger Institute in Baltimore, Maryland.The Kennedy Krieger Institute is a multidisciplinary diagnostic center serving children from around the world.Additionally, she served as curriculum consultant to Pace University in new York City, NY, in the area of inclusion and special education.

    Before receiving the Johns Hopkins Fellowship, Dr. Sweet-Darter was a member of the School of Education tenured faculty at Phillips University in Enid, OK.Also, while in Enid, she served as Director for the Family Center and the Learning Center, a multidisciplinary family service and educational center.

    A longtime advocate for persons with developmental disabilities, Dr. Sweet-Darter has served in various educational, counseling, school psychology, and community-school partnerships. she is a native Oklahoma with a Bachelors from Oklahoma State University, a Masters from Southwestern Oklahoma State University, and a Ph.D. from the University of Oklahoma.

    UCO is pleased to welcome Dr. Mary Sweet-Darter as the newest faculty member in the psychology department at the University of Central Oklahoma.Dr. Sweet-Darter is teaching courses in the School Psychology Program at UCO.

    Dr. Sweet-Darter comes to the University of Central Oklahoma from Northeastern State University's psychology department where she was coordinator of the post-graduate school psychology program.Prior to serving at NSU, she was a clinician and research fellow at Johns Hopkins' Kennedy Krieger Institute in Baltimore, Maryland, and a faculty member at Pace University in New York.Mary grew up in Oklahoma, earned her doctorate from the University of Oklahoma and taught at Phillips University in Enid, Oklahoma.While at Phillips, she also directed a community counseling and human services center as well as a school-based services grant in cooperation with the Department of Corrections, Office of Juvenile Affairs, and the local Community Development Support Association.

    Mary and her husband, Rev. Jerry Darter have several children and grandchildren living in the Oklahoma City area and look forward to serving at UCO and being near their family.
